The role is funded by the UKRI Future Leaders Fellowship, investigating Digital Hydraulic Fluid Power Technologies for Decarbonising Off-road Vehicles. 

Hydraulic fluid power has several advantages, such as high power density, compactness, low weight, fast response, and good controllability. However, the current hydraulic control method involves using valves to throttle flow, reduce pressure, and control the speed and force of the load. Although this approach is simple to operate, it is highly energy inefficient, and the average power efficiency of fluid power systems is only about 21%.

This project aims to design, develop and prototype next-generation digital hydraulic technologies and control systems to significantly improve hydraulic energy efficiency, fuel consumption, and CO2 emissions to decarbonise off-road vehicles for a sustainable and greener future.
